Ralph F. Manz, 90, of Kiel, passed away on Friday, January 2, 2026 at home. Ralph was born September 11, 1935, in the Town of New Holstein, to the late Ben and Nelda (Rehm) Manz. He graduated from Kiel High School in 1954. Ralph proudly served his country in the United States Marine Corps from 1954 until 1956. On April 11, 1959, he married the former Dorothy Garbe at Ss. Peter and Paul Church.

Ralph was recognized by Old Glory Honor Flight #48. It was an experience he was very proud of.

Ralph was a volunteer fire fighter with the Kiel Fire Department and a member of Kiel Fish and Game. He was also a former member of the Kiel VFW. He enjoyed hunting and fishing.

In addition to his wife, Dorothy, Ralph is survived by his children, Gail (Don) Krause, Barbara (Robert) Pontow, Richard Manz, James (Jackie) Manz, Mark Manz (Amy Becker) and Sue (Vern) Michels; 10 grandchildren; 34 great-grandchildren and two sisters-in-law, Rosie (Bob) Williams and Katie (Ernie) Dyer. He is further survived by nieces, nephews, other relatives and friends.

In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by his brother, Donald (Lorriane) Manz, his sister, Doris (Alan) Maurer, his infant sister, Dorothy Manz, his sisters-in-law, Patricia Bignell and Virginia Schneider, his brothers-in-law, Paul Garbe Jr. and Kenneth Schneider and his father-in-law and mother-in-law, Paul and Agnes (Mahloch) Garbe.

In accordance with Ralph's wishes, private family services will be held.

The family would like to thank Jordan Loose, Calumet County Hospice, Meals on Wheels, the Kiel Police Department and the Kiel Ambulance Service for their care, concern and support.
